Transaction 4514f50fd42e900e53dc96bfec4c874d5268ddbfcbfa721c4a0486a7713ab8ff

125 Input
1 Outputs
  • 4514f50fd42e900e53dc96bfec4c874d5268ddbfcbfa721c4a0486a7713ab8ff:0
  • value  118976000
    address  35uhmk4B8GTyY22pTEUMJBKrV4PWtBuohC